Output 33994805ffc24e855f295b2a7ad6e45d6436a82292ed1bb391dc3badbbf10029:2

value
1393242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d08de1f29075e155414cb2fb01ad7c16ef7e85 OP_EQUAL
address
3BX64fu5zYmJ7Dy8WqY1ndzc7HWbY18zHF
transaction
33994805ffc24e855f295b2a7ad6e45d6436a82292ed1bb391dc3badbbf10029
spent
true